    Best Neighborhoods in Dallas, TX — Key Takeaways

    The best neighborhood in Dallas is Deep Ellum with a Kurby Score of 80/100. Dallas has 4 neighborhoods ranked by quality of life data. The safest neighborhood is Oak Lawn with a violent crime rate of 0.9 per 1,000 residents, 75% below the national average of 3.6. The most affordable is Bishop Arts with a median home value of $280,000. The most walkable is Deep Ellum with a Walk Score of 98/100.

    Dallas has a population of 1,304,379, a median household income of $52,210, an unemployment rate of 3.8%, and a poverty rate of 17.5%. The median home value citywide is $275,000, which is near the national average.

    Data sourced from the US Census Bureau, FBI Crime Data Explorer, EPA AirNow, Walk Score, and FEMA. Last updated: March 2026.

    How We Rank Neighborhoods in Dallas

    Neighborhoods are ranked using the Kurby Score, a composite quality-of-life index that evaluates seven weighted categories based on publicly available data:

    Affordability
    20% weight
    Walkability & Transit
    15% weight
    Safety
    15% weight
    Environment
    15% weight
    Housing Market
    15% weight
    Education
    10% weight
    Economy
    10% weight

    Each category incorporates multiple data points. For example, Safety uses both violent and property crime rates; Environment considers air quality (AQI), noise levels, climate risk, and flood zone status; Housing Market factors in vacancy rates, homeownership rates, and effective tax rates.

    Data Sources: US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ates, FBI Uniform Crime Reporting (UCR), EPA AirNow, Walk Score, DOT National Transportation Noise Map, FEMA National Flood Hazard Layer,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), and EIA Electricity Data. All data is updated on a rolling basis as new government releases become available.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What are the cheapest neighborhoods in Dallas?
    The most affordable neighborhoods in Dallas by median home value are: Bishop Arts, Deep Ellum, Oak Lawn, Uptown Dallas. Rankings are based on Census ACS housing data.
    What is the cheapest neighborhood to buy a home in Dallas?
    Bishop Arts has the lowest median home value at $280,000. The national median is $281,900.
    Where is the cheapest rent in Dallas?
    Bishop Arts has the lowest median rent at $1,049/month. The national median rent is $1,163/month.
    Which neighborhood in Dallas has the highest income?
    Oak Lawn has the highest median household income at $109,884. The national median is $74,580.
    What is the median home value in Dallas?
    The median home value in Dallas, TX is $275,000. The national median is $281,900.
